Position Summary:
The Processing Lab Assistant receives all laboratory specimens arriving from hospital, clinic and branches. Verifies that acceptance criteria are met with regard to patient identification, suitable specimen types, and recommends method of transport/storage. Performs registration and order entry functions as needed.

Receives and processes incoming lab specimens as appropriate. Specimen types include but are not limited to blood, urine, stool, and body fluids.
Assesses all specimens for appropriate labeling, specimen type and shipping conditions. Completes event reporting for specimens not meeting requirements.
Performs specimen registration in the electronic medical record and order entry and specimen receiving in the Laboratory computer system.
Performs specimen processing and preparation as needed. Ensures proper specimen type, container and storage temperature for tests performed by Carle lab and those sent to reference labs.
Loads samples onto laboratory instrumentation in accordance with established protocols.
